Simple soap and lessons slash school sick days
NCT ID NCT07467902
Summary
This study tested if teaching kids about handwashing and providing soap in schools could prevent common illnesses and reduce missed school days. Researchers worked with over 800 children, aged 9-13, in Erbil, Iraq. Some schools received monthly hygiene lessons and soap, while others did not, to see if the program led to fewer cases of colds, flu, and stomach bugs.
